ELD is the electrical load detector. It measures electrical load so the ECU can control the alternator & the idle speed. At least on the car's I've owned, the ELD is built into the under-hood fusebox, so if it's bad you have to replace the fusebox. But check the ELD wiring from the fusebox to the ECU. Don't buy a new fusebox if the real problem is a broken wire.